Eutectic growth

Eutectic growth is a special mode of solidification for a two-component system. Operating near a specific point in the phase diagram, it shows some unique features [121,137]. [Pg.900]

The above classification scheme can also be applied to two-phase growth ( ). When both phases are low entropy-change the growth kinetics are unimportant and diffusion dominates. This leads to rod or lamellar eutectic growth forms, as shown in Fig. 8. Figure 9 shows the calculated shape of such an interface compared to the observed shape for various growth conditions ( ). Eutectic growth axes correspond to well-defined crystallographic directions and crystallographic relations between phases, which are unique in most systems. [Pg.307]
